Beloved Canadian footwear brand to open its first Vancouver store next month

Known for its fashion-forward and sustainably-made footwear, Poppy Barley is a star on the rise when it comes to luxury brands in Canada. After years of hosting pop-up shops, the Alberta-born brand is finally opening its first-ever brick-and-mortar location in Vancouver. The best part? Shoppers won’t have to wait long at all to check it out!

As a certified B Corporation, the brand is committed to crafting ethically-produced footwear at the family-owned factories they’ve partnered with. Their mission? Creating luxury for “people and the planet.”

This translates to fairly-priced products that are made to last – and quality with every step.

Although newcomers to shoemaking, sisters Justine and Kendall Barber launched Poppy Barley in 2012 to create reliable, everyday designs that compliment your wardrobe without compromising on the health of the planet.

“We wanted to design boots, shoes and accessories for people like us—for people like you,” their website reads. “People who care about comfort and style, but absolutely refuse to compromise their values of caring for the planet and people.”

Although the opening date is still in the works, shoppers can expect to visit the new Kitsilano location this May, which means we’re just weeks away from being able to peruse their collections in person.

Until then, a scroll through their website or Instagram feed is sure to get you inspired for spring wear.

Poppy Barley Kitsilano

When: TBA, May 2023
Where: 2144 West 4th Avenue
